The Factors that Influence the Cost of Sheer Curtains

Material, size, brand, and customisation options are the most common factors that will determine how much your sheer curtains are going to cost.

  • Material: The choice of fabric plays a significant role in determining the total cost of your curtain. The prices can range from affordable to expensive, depending on the quality and colour options of the fabric. In some cases, even the opacity of the fabric can be affected by the price. For instance, curtains made from low-end fabrics may cost as little as $7 per panel, while premium materials like silk, brocade, and linen can cost about $150 per panel.
  • Size: The size of the curtains, including width and length, can directly impact the price. A standard-sized panel ranges from 38 cm to 127 cm wide, with the most common length for standard window panels being 213 cm and 91 cm for kitchen and bathroom curtains. Larger curtains may require more fabric and labour, thus increasing the cost.
  • Brand: The cost of sheer curtains may be influenced by the brand or designer name associated with them. High-end brands or well-known designer names often come at a premium, mainly due to their reputation, quality, and design expertise. These premium curtain brands often don’t advertise their prices but instead offer free consultation and quotations with their expert designers.
  • Customisation Options: Customised curtains can be more expensive compared to off-the-shelf options. The consultation fee, design, and sewing time for custom sheer curtains can all contribute to the overall cost. More intricate designs may require a longer sewing time, further increasing the price.

Cost-Saving Tips for Buying Sheer Curtains

You can enjoy further savings by following these tips:

Shop During Sales or Promotional Periods

Shopping during sales provides a much-needed price cut that sees premium curtains like hemp and linen that haven’t sold go for the price of lower-cost materials such as voile. You can also try to time your purchase with a promotional period. These are typically offered during the holidays or around major events like End Of Financial Year and Stocktake Clearances. If you know you’ll be needing new curtains soon, then keep an eye out for sales and promotions so that you can take advantage of them while they last!

Consider Buying Online

Online shopping can be a great way to save money on curtains. Online stores often have lower overhead costs than physical stores, so they’re able to pass some of those savings onto customers by offering lower prices. You may also find that online retailers offer coupons and discounts that make their prices even more competitive than those at local shops.

Compare Prices and Look for Bargains

It’s wise to visit different retailers, both online and in-store, to compare prices and be on the lookout for sales or discounts. While online retailers may be able to save on overheads, some physical retailers, especially those small family run shops, may have exclusive in-store discounts that are worth checking out.

Additionally, the shipping costs for some online suppliers can be quite high, which can make the total cost significantly more expensive than the published price.
